Yarn O'clock is a charming wool shop located at 2 Earl Road, Mold, offering a curated selection of high-quality yarns perfect for knitting, crochet, and textile crafts. Open Tuesday to Saturday with welcoming hours, this boutique store is beloved for its friendly service and versatile yarns, including the popular Cambrian Welsh wool. It’s an inspiring spot for both beginners and experienced crafters seeking unique materials and expert advice.

A Local Gem for Yarn Lovers

Nestled in the heart of Mold, Yarn O'clock has established itself as a beloved destination for crafters and wool enthusiasts. Since opening, it has become known for its warm, inviting atmosphere and carefully selected range of yarns that cater to a variety of textile arts. The shop’s location on Earl Road places it conveniently within the town, making it an accessible stop for locals and visitors alike.

Exceptional Yarn Selection and Quality

Yarn O'clock prides itself on offering high-quality yarns, including the versatile Cambrian Welsh wool known for its excellent stitch definition. This wool is ideal for intricate knitting techniques such as lacework, colorwork, and cables, making it a favorite among serious knitters. The shop’s stock includes a range of weights and textures, allowing crafters to find the perfect yarn for everything from delicate gloves to cozy cardigans.

Welcoming Hours and Community Spirit

Open from Tuesday to Friday between 10am and 5pm, and Saturdays from 10am to 4pm, Yarn O'clock provides ample opportunity to browse and shop. The owner often stays later by arrangement, reflecting a dedication to customer service. The shop also participates in local events, such as opening special hours during the Mold Christmas Market, fostering a strong community connection.
